About Us:

MusicWorx is more than a workplace—it’s a place to grow, lead, and make meaningful change. Founded in 1987 by Dr. Barbara Reuer, a pioneer in the field, our San Diego-based agency has been at the forefront of music therapy innovation for over 35 years. We’ve served thousands of clients across hospitals, schools, clinics, and communities—and we’re still growing.

Job Details

Position: Full-Time Board-Certified Music Therapist (MT-BC)

Start Date: August 1, 2025 (flexible)

Location: San Diego County, CA (school, clinic, and community-based settings)

Compensation: $30–$36+ per hour, depending on experience

Benefits:

  • Health, dental, vision insurance (optional)
  • Paid time off
  • CBMT dues + CEU stipend
  • Mileage reimbursement
  • Company laptop/tablet
  • Access to Zoom/phone app + extensive instrument and resource library


You'll Thrive Here If You:

  • Are MT-BC certified (or eligible)
  • Have strong clinical musicianship (voice, guitar, piano, percussion)
  • Love working with neurodivergent, medical, and school-aged clients
  • Communicate with clarity, empathy, and respect
  • Value teamwork, accountability, and community care
  • Embrace flexibility, inclusion, and lifelong learning
  • Are licensed to drive and can travel to client sites across the county

Bonus: Experience with IEPs, Spanish fluency, and/or trauma-informed care is a plus!


Responsibilities:

  • Deliver individual and group music therapy services aligned with client goals
  • Conduct assessments, create treatment plans, and document progress
  • Collaborate with teachers, healthcare providers, and families
  • Contribute to community-based wellness events and trainings
  • Participate in team meetings, supervision, and continued learning
  • Represent MusicWorx with professionalism, creativity, and compassion
